Output 63494125d2b19fbb47135e3e11a1bc973f3c0dc938302ecbd4da40d198d19a23: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fb4c59ea587046efc0743b0f78b3a7988cd575 OP_EQUAL
address
3MHja6yL8Wv6LxsfACGsXrZ6pmb2HscQ9J
transaction
63494125d2b19fbb47135e3e11a1bc973f3c0dc938302ecbd4da40d198d19a23
confirmations
325805
spent
true